Taliban began seizure of three regional capitals

Forbidden in Russia, the Taliban organization seized three regional capitals in Afghanistan, continuing to rapidly conquer the country’s territory, reports mk.ru.

On Sunday, they captured control over the key North city of Kunduz, as well as over Sari pool and Toulokan.

This means that from Friday the militants attacked five regional capitals, and Kunduz became their most important achievement this year. Taliban said that the government has no ceasefire agreement.

The representative of the group warned against further intervention of the United States to Afghanistan, speaking on Sunday on the Al Jazeera TV channel.
